The North Rim of Grand Canyon National Park is set to open in less than a month, with the park welcoming guests in the area on Thursday, May 15 at 6am. Both Grand Canyon Trail Rides and Grand Canyon Lodge will also commence on that day.

The Bright Angel Point Trail will be closed for construction throughout the 2025 season. National Park Service personnel will be working to replace asphalt and move large rocks in the areas throughout the season. The closure will help to protect both staff and the visiting public during the repairs.

North Rim access for day use will continue either until November 30, 2025, or until the first major snowstorm of the year if it comes before that date.
